How to Bake the Best Classic Chocolate Chip Muffins

1. Introduction to Baking Chocolate Chip Muffins

There's nothing quite like the smell of freshly baked chocolate chip muffins filling the kitchen. Whether you're baking for a special occasion or simply craving a sweet snack, these muffins are a delicious treat that never goes out of style. In this guide, we’ll walk you through the process of making the best classic chocolate chip muffins from scratch, ensuring that each bite is soft, fluffy, and full of chocolatey goodness.

2. Essential Ingredients for Perfect Muffins

Before you start, it's important to gather all the ingredients you'll need to make the best chocolate chip muffins. Here are the essentials:

2.1 Flour and Baking Powder

All-purpose flour is your base, and baking powder is the leavening agent that helps the muffins rise. Make sure to use fresh ingredients for the best texture.

2.2 Sugar and Butter

Granulated sugar gives your muffins the perfect sweetness, while butter (preferably unsalted) adds richness and flavor. Be sure to melt the butter before mixing it into the wet ingredients.

2.3 Eggs and Milk

Eggs provide structure to the muffins, while milk ensures they stay moist. You can use any type of milk—whole, skim, or plant-based—depending on your preference.

2.4 Chocolate Chips

The star of the show: chocolate chips! Use high-quality semi-sweet chocolate chips for the best flavor. You can also experiment with different types of chocolate, such as dark or milk chocolate, to suit your taste.

3. Step-by-Step Guide to Baking Chocolate Chip Muffins

Now that you have all your ingredients ready, it's time to bake! Follow these steps for the perfect chocolate chip muffins:

3.1 Preheat Your Oven

Start by preheating your oven to 375°F (190°C). This ensures that the muffins will bake evenly.

3.2 Prepare the Dry Ingredients

In a large bowl, sift together the flour, baking powder, and a pinch of salt. Sifting helps to ensure that the dry ingredients are evenly mixed, which results in lighter muffins.

3.3 Mix the Wet Ingredients

In a separate bowl, whisk together the melted butter, sugar, eggs, and milk. Mix until well combined and smooth.

3.4 Combine Wet and Dry Ingredients

Gradually add the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ients, stirring gently to combine. Be careful not to overmix, as this can make your muffins dense.

3.5 Fold in the Chocolate Chips

Gently fold in the chocolate chips, making sure they’re evenly distributed throughout the batter.

3.6 Fill the Muffin Tin

Spoon the muffin batter into a greased or lined muffin tin, filling each cup about 2/3 full. This gives the muffins enough room to rise without overflowing.

3.7 Bake

Place the muffin tin in the preheated oven and bake for about 18–20 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ean. Keep an eye on them, as baking times may vary depending on your oven.

3.8 Cool and Enjoy

Allow the muffins to cool in the tin for 5 min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ely. Enjoy your delicious chocolate chip muffins with a cup of coffee or tea!

4. Expert Tips for Perfect Muffins Every Time

To ensure your chocolate chip muffins turn out perfectly every time, here are a few expert tips:

4.1 Use Room Temperature Ingredients

For the best texture, make sure your butter, eggs, and milk are at room temperature before you start baking. This helps the ingredients blend together more easily, resulting in a smoother batter.

4.2 Don’t Overmix the Batter

Overmixing can lead to dense muffins. Stir just until the ingredients are combined, and be sure to fold in the chocolate chips gently.

5. Common Mistakes to Avoid

While baking chocolate chip muffins is relatively simple, there are some common mistakes that can affect the final product. Here’s what to avoid:

5.1 Using Cold Butter

Using cold butter can result in uneven mixing and a greasy batter. Always melt your butter before using it in the recipe.

5.2 Overfilling the Muffin Tin

Overfilling the muffin tin can lead to muffins that overflow or don’t rise properly. Stick to the 2/3 rule for the perfect muffin rise.
